I am not sure if H. pylori is related to hair loss.
It is common for children to carry H. pylori.
But children are normally asymptomatic and because antibiotics could disturb the development of their microbiome, we dont normally recommend treatment for children.
However, since your child is obviously affected by H. pylori, you can check with the doctor about vonoprazan and amoxicillin, dual drug therapy. This combination should be safe for children.
Helico_expert wrote:I am not sure if H. pylori is correlated to hair loss. However, it has generally been believed that H. pylori infect human since young. Studies have shown that people as young as 2 years old has already been infected with H. pylori.
H. pylori infected almost 50% of the world population. However not everyone is symptomatic. Many people carry it without knowing for life.
